adjective
- relating to or affecting the colon (large intestine)
Usage: medical
noun
- a procedure involving irrigation of the colon with water
Usage: medical; alternative medicine
Examples
- The doctor ordered a colonic examination to check for abnormalities.
- Colonic inflammation can cause severe abdominal pain.
- She scheduled a colonic at the wellness center.
- The patient experienced colonic bleeding after the procedure.
- Many people believe colonics help with digestive health.
- The colonic muscles contract to move waste through the intestine.
